Introducing the Monthly Cookbook Series! On the last Wednesday of every month, Starting June 30 at 7pm, Lisa Higgins of Sweetpea Baking Company, and myself (Michelle of Herbivore) will host a fun educational event to promote vegan cooking, vegan cookbooks, and learning new skills in the kitchen. Events will be at Sweetpea, 1205 SE Stark St. in Portland. Woo!
Our first book and demo is the awesome new Viva Vegan by Terry Hope Romero. Don’t know what sopes are? Fear not. Interested in an empanada? So are we! Lisa and I will choose 3 or so recipes from the book, demonstrate new techniques and ingredients, demystify them, get you involved and doing something new too, and then we can all chow down. These events are limited to 20 people,and it’s now full. We look forward to seeing you there!
